Wedbush Securities's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Wedbush Securities held 913 positions worth $671M, up 9.9% from $611M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Wedbush Securities deployed $46.3M of net new capital in Q3 2016, opening 123 new positions and adding to 382 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Triton International Limited: 92,729 shares worth $1.22M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 24% of assets, up from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Real Estate.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ares 0-1 Year Treasury Bond ETF, an estimated $1.06M trimmed.
